BAL266173 Portrait of the Marshal of the Soviet Union and Poland, Konstantin Rokossovsky (1896-1968), 1944 (oil on canvas) by Yakovlev, Vassily Nikolayevich (1893-1953); 196x136 cm; Regional Art Museum, Kurgan, Russia; (add.info.: having been sent to a labour camp at Norilsk in the Great Purge of 1937 he was released without explanation in 1940, presumably due to preparation for war;)

This striking portrait captures the formidable presence of Marshal Konstantin Rokossovsky, a key figure in both Soviet and Polish military history. Painted by Vassily Nikolayevich Yakovlev in 1944, during the tumultuous years of World War II, this oil on canvas masterpiece showcases Rokossovsky's steely gaze and commanding stance. Rokossovsky's life was marked by hardship and resilience; after being unjustly sent to a labor camp during Stalin's Great Purge, he emerged as a hero of the Eastern Front. His release in 1940 paved the way for his crucial role in leading Soviet forces to victory against Nazi Germany. Adorned with medals and decorations that speak to his bravery and leadership, Rokossovsky stands tall as a symbol of strength and determination. The painting exudes an aura of authority and confidence, reflecting his unwavering commitment to defending his homeland.
